Many small business owners and entrepreneurs go into business with big hopes and dreams of earning a sustainable living and creating financial freedom for themselves and their families. But what often gets in the way are hidden blockages to abundance—what is commonly called the trauma of money.
In this engaging culturally responsive webinar, we’ll explore:
What the trauma of money is and how it shows up in entrepreneursHow unresolved trauma can shape financial decisions, business growth, and feelings of worthinessSomatic tools and trauma-informed strategies to shift these patternsPractical tips for creating new outcomes—for yourself, your family, and your community
You’ll walk away with a deeper understanding of how your nervous system impacts your relationship with money and practical strategies you can start applying right away.
